Make48 Make48 is a competition & community for everyday innovators. Make48 provides the tools and technicians to build your prototype.

Make48, the “world’s fastest invention competition”, is the nationwide invention documentary series that gives teams exactly 48 hours to come up with an idea and build a prototype based on a challenge. Teams present their working prototype and promotional video to a panel of judges. One winning team wins a cash prize! Make48 is the brainchild of a group of Kansas City-based inventors who have been

developing and launching products for decades. Their passion for inventing and problem solving led to the creation of Make48. The series is unscripted and consists of experts, entrepreneurs and the everyday inventor’s race to beat the clock and come up with the next big idea. Season 3 is currently airing on local PBS/APT (American Public Television) stations across the country. Watch seasons 1, 2 and 3 by going to Amazon Prime Video, PBS.org or Make48.com.

We’re still buzzing from a weekend fueled by girl power and innovation!

Huge congratulations to our trophy winners:

1ST PLACE – BEST INNOVATION: The Dream Makers from Kansas State School for the Blind. Sponsored by Heartland Black Chamber and KC Blind All-Stars
2ND PLACE - RUNNER UP: CTEC CAPS Creators sponsored by Neighbors Construction
BEST USE OF AGILITIES: Southern Heat from Houston, TX. Sponsored by Fervo Energy and Kiewit

The top two teams will be joining us this November at Season 9 Nationals and we can’t wait to see what they bring to the table! These young innovators blew us away with their creativity, collaboration, and unstoppable energy.
